Output e2f30601aebbd8ef86e3df730dbdf04a0b5cedc1b4783c1d7c8a21ce7d3ee2be:0

value
24400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77faba381e84f5b4ddd50c9b02c3fc1423f182cc OP_EQUAL
address
3CdQhDbk1tpdrA3vpnT1DZd6uqTsmeTPX2
transaction
e2f30601aebbd8ef86e3df730dbdf04a0b5cedc1b4783c1d7c8a21ce7d3ee2be
confirmations
351758
spent
true